Why Do We Sometimes Throw Up In Our Mouths. Vomiting — forcefully expelling what’s in your stomach through your mouth — is your body’s way of getting rid of something harmful in the stomach. It’s usually accompanied by an icky taste in the back of the mouth. My understanding is that it’s called acid reflux and is caused by a relaxation of the lower oesophageal sphincter that holds the top of the stomach. Regurgitation is the involuntary return of consumed food up your throat into your mouth. Vomiting, or throwing up, is the forcible emptying of the stomach contents through the mouth.
